A Vital Component of Women's Health: Understanding Testosterone Replacement Therapy (TRT) Injections
When people hear "testosterone," they often think only of men’s health. However, testosterone is a crucial hormone for women's well-being. It is essential for maintaining energy, mood, muscle strength, bone density, and sexual function.
As women age, testosterone levels decline, often leading to a range of challenging symptoms.
At Low T Nation we offer tailored Testosterone Replacement Therapy (TRT) via injections as a highly effective solution for restoring vitality and balance.
Why Women Need Testosterone
- Energy and Vitality: Balanced testosterone levels help combat fatigue and increase overall energy and stamina.
- Mood and Cognition: It plays a role in mental clarity, focus, and emotional stability, helping to alleviate symptoms of depression and anxiety.
- Physical Strength: Testosterone is vital for maintaining lean muscle mass and supporting bone density, protecting against osteoporosis.
- Libido and Sexual Function: testosterone therapy can significantly improve sexual desire, arousal, and orgasm function.
